New Tom Clancys Rainbow Six Siege Event Turns Players Into Legends Of Japan

0

Ubisoft has just announced Rengoku, a new limited-time in-game event that will be available in Rainbow Six Siege between Tuesday, April 26th and May 17th. Among other new features, players will be able to explore the area control game mode with Kiba loading and fast respawn, features that make the gameplay even more dynamic and action-packed.

Set in Japan, Rengoku features a temple in the sky where the operators are spirit-possessed samurai warriors who fight for the honor of the gods and eternity. In the new version of the Skyscraper map and in 5v5 mode, players from each team will need to stay close to the altars scattered throughout the scenario for five seconds in order to gain control points or take them from opponents. The location of these control altars changes every two minutes and the first team to reach 300 points wins the match.

In this operation, players will be able to use Kiba explosives, which destroy the enemy in just one attack, in addition to shotguns and pistols. Fuze, Osa, Rook and Thunderbird can choose between Fire or Poison Kiba, while Twitch, Ziofia, Kapkan, Bandit and Maestro have Flashback or Knockback Kiba at their disposal.

The event also features the Rengoku Collection, a set of Operator uniforms, helmets, weapons, and cards, and a Battlefield Spirit set that includes weapon skins, accessories, talismans, and backgrounds. The Rengoku Collection Pack can be purchased by completing special event quests for 300 R6 Credits or 12,500 Fame. Individual packages cost 1680 R6 credits each.
